What is CPR?
Cardiopulmonary resuscitation (MOUTH-TO-MOUTH RESUSCITATION) is a lifesaving strategy made use of throughout emergencies when a person's heartbeat or breathing has actually quit. It consists of upper body compressions and rescue breaths that aid preserve blood circulation to crucial organs till expert clinical help gets here. Frequently Asked Concerns (FAQs) About Teenager CPR Training
1. What age needs to teenagers begin taking CPR courses?
Most organizations recommend beginning as early as 12 years old; nonetheless, younger children can also learn fundamental concepts through ideal programs customized to their age group.
2. How much time does it take to complete a first aid course?
Training courses normally vary from 4 hours approximately 16 hours depending on web content deepness-- the standard being around 8 hours.
3. Are there any type of prerequisites before enrolling?
No official prerequisites exist; nevertheless, it's handy if individuals have an understanding of fundamental medical terms.
4. Will I get accreditation after finishing my course?
Yes! Upon effective completion and passing any necessary evaluations you'll receive an official emergency treatment certificate valid for 2 years.
5. Can I take these programs online?
Numerous organizations supply hybrid layouts incorporating on the internet concept with called for functional sessions held in person-- this is advised by market standards.
6. Is it essential to restore my qualification periodically?
Yes! Normal recertification guarantees your abilities continue to be proficient and up-to-date according to existing guidelines.
